Professional dress is very important. It establishes your credibility with school/district administration and your students. Here are thoughts you should consider:
Be comfortable but not overly casual.
Wear items that make you feel good and confident.
Understand the dress code and culture of your placement.
Practice good personal hygiene.
When selecting clothes to wear in your placement, it is important to consider what message they send. It is important that you consider how your clothing choice:
Affects Your Performance
Portrays a Positive Perception of Yourself
Has a Favorable Impact on Your Current Career Mobility
